Factors Influencing Inspection Frequencies
Several factors come into play when determining the appropriate inspection frequencies for tower chimneys. These factors can vary depending on the type of chimney, its operating conditions, and the regulatory requirements in place. Here are some of the key factors to consider:
- Chimney Material: Different chimney materials have varying levels of durability and resistance to corrosion and wear. For example, Fiberglass Tower Chimney is known for its excellent corrosion resistance and lightweight properties, while Titanium Steel Composite Plate Tower Chimney offers high strength and resistance to harsh environments. The material of the chimney can affect its lifespan and the frequency of inspections required to detect any signs of deterioration.
- Operating Conditions: The operating conditions of the chimney, such as the temperature, pressure, and chemical composition of the exhaust gases, can have a significant impact on its structural integrity. Chimneys that operate under extreme conditions, such as high temperatures or corrosive environments, may require more frequent inspections to ensure that they are not being damaged by the harsh operating conditions.
- Age of the Chimney: As a chimney ages, it is more likely to develop signs of wear and tear, such as cracks, corrosion, or structural damage. Older chimneys may require more frequent inspections to detect any potential issues before they become major problems.
- Regulatory Requirements: Depending on the location and the type of industry, there may be specific regulatory requirements regarding the inspection frequencies for tower chimneys. These requirements are typically designed to ensure the safety of the chimney and the surrounding environment. It is important to stay up-to-date with the relevant regulations and ensure that your chimney inspections comply with them.
General Inspection Frequencies
Based on the factors mentioned above, here are some general guidelines for the inspection frequencies of tower chimneys:
- Initial Inspection: Before a new chimney is put into service, it should undergo a thorough initial inspection to ensure that it has been installed correctly and that it meets all the relevant safety standards. This initial inspection should be conducted by a qualified professional and should include a visual inspection, a structural analysis, and any necessary testing.
- Annual Inspections: For most tower chimneys, an annual inspection is recommended to detect any signs of wear and tear, corrosion, or structural damage. During an annual inspection, a qualified inspector will conduct a visual inspection of the chimney, looking for any signs of cracks, leaks, or other abnormalities. They may also perform non-destructive testing, such as ultrasonic testing or magnetic particle testing, to detect any internal defects that may not be visible to the naked eye.
- Periodic Inspections: In addition to annual inspections, some chimneys may require periodic inspections at more frequent intervals. For example, chimneys that operate under extreme conditions or that are made of materials that are more susceptible to corrosion may require inspections every six months or even more frequently. The specific frequency of these periodic inspections will depend on the factors mentioned above and should be determined based on a risk assessment conducted by a qualified professional.
- Post-Event Inspections: In the event of a significant event, such as an earthquake, a fire, or a severe storm, it is important to conduct a post-event inspection of the chimney to ensure that it has not been damaged. Even if the chimney appears to be undamaged after the event, it is still recommended to have it inspected by a qualified professional to rule out any hidden damage.
Importance of Regular Inspections
Regular inspections of tower chimneys are essential for several reasons:
- Safety: The primary reason for conducting regular inspections is to ensure the safety of the chimney and the surrounding environment. By detecting any signs of wear and tear, corrosion, or structural damage early on, it is possible to take corrective action before the problem becomes a major safety hazard.
- Compliance: As mentioned earlier, there may be specific regulatory requirements regarding the inspection frequencies for tower chimneys. By conducting regular inspections and keeping accurate records of them, you can ensure that your chimney complies with all the relevant regulations and avoid any potential fines or penalties.
- Cost Savings: Regular inspections can help to identify any potential problems early on, allowing you to take corrective action before the problem becomes more severe and costly to repair. By investing in regular inspections, you can save money in the long run by avoiding major repairs or even the replacement of the chimney.
- Operational Efficiency: A well-maintained chimney is more likely to operate efficiently, reducing energy consumption and improving the overall performance of the industrial process. By conducting regular inspections and addressing any issues promptly, you can ensure that your chimney is operating at its optimal level.
